Output 670b55b3a146c8e456084f2420a35fca19bf3757f3f5b2435d427c883eb383e8:0

value
26753000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16e6b70fb734451f53fb59ccf8e30e2a4a947195 OP_EQUAL
address
M9zFV1rNeFgswALTnGsWvwHsXLHZqCFPK4
transaction
670b55b3a146c8e456084f2420a35fca19bf3757f3f5b2435d427c883eb383e8
spent
true